JWalton made a debug version and gave me dbx output. The crash is in a  
perfectly OK and normal draw of a button... with just a small malloc().  
Usually it's a sign something really big (elswhere) is screwing up  
memory.

He did for the first time a full compile with engine/solid/qhull, and  
had to upgrade IRIX for it. Too many unknown variables for me to  
support remotely. Needs someone hands-on at the system to check if all  
went OK with compiling/linking.
